Fulbright chair brings leading US scholars to Canberra

The Australian National University has signed a deal with the Australian-American Fulbright Commission to set up a Fulbright distinguished chair in the arts, humanities and social sciences in Canberra.

Announcing the five-year research agreement on 26 May, vice-chancellor Ian Young said it will “enable exceptional senior scholars from the United States to undertake a semester of research in the area of arts, humanities and social sciences” at the ANU.

The Fulbright chair will start in 2016, and is one of five distinguished chairs to be offered at Australian universities and research agencies.
